    The rise in the price level may be due to an increase in aggregate demand or a decrease in aggregate supply. Both of these factors make aggregate demand greater than aggregate supply, leading to an increase in the price level.

    However, the cause of a steady and sustained rise in the price level is a steady and sustained increase in aggregate demand. This is because aggregate supply cannot be reduced steadily and sustainably.

    The reason for the steady and sustained increase in aggregate demand is the sustained increase in the money supply. Persistent inflation is essentially a monetary phenomenon.

    Why are prices high in cities? There are two reasons, one, there are many people, the demand is large, and no matter how high it is, some people will buy it. Second, add-on**.

    Extra** is the superposition of all costs on a commodity, such as transportation fees, road expenses, rent, countless people's handling and unloading costs, taxes, and so on. The selling price of a commodity with a factory cost of only one cent can reach five yuan, and the reason is in these intermediate links.

    The convenience of the city is based on the cost, and the price will inevitably cover those costs.

    The high cost of living in big cities does put a lot of people off, but why are so many people still squeezing into big cities? Here are a few possible reasons.

    First of all, big cities have more development opportunities and career prospects. Large cities are home to a wide variety of businesses and industries, as well as more high-paying jobs and career opportunities. For people who want to have a better career and career development, big cities are where their dreams come true.

    Second, big cities have a better quality of life and more resources. Big cities are home to a variety of cultural and entertainment venues, high-quality medical resources, high-end educational institutions, and so on. These resources provide more choices and convenience for residents of large cities, and also meet people's needs for a high-quality life.

    Third, big cities have a wider circle of people. Big cities bring together talents and people from all over the world, and everyone has the opportunity to meet more friends and colleagues and expand their network. This broad circle of people can make it easier for people to access support and opportunities, stimulate their creativity and potential, and allow them to experience more different cultures and ideas.

    Fourth, big cities are the inheritors and innovators of culture. Big cities have a more diverse culture, where people can feel a wide variety of cultures, customs, and ideas. In addition, big cities also have more cultural facilities such as art venues and museums, providing people with more opportunities to come into contact with art and culture.

    At the same time, the big city is also an important place for cultural innovation, hosting many emerging forces in the fields of art, design and technology, as well as a number of national research institutions and innovation parks.

    Finally, big cities are also dream fulfillments. Many people aspire to have a satisfying job and life in a big city, which may be an excellent career, a romantic love, or an achievement with personal value. These dreams may be difficult to achieve in small towns, but in big cities, people can find opportunities that suit them and make their dreams come true.

    In conclusion, although the high cost of living in large cities is indeed high, they also have many attractive advantages, including more career opportunities, better quality of life and resources, a wider circle of people, a more diverse culture and an innovative environment, etc. These advantages have attracted a large number of people to pour into the big cities, and have become an important part of the big cities and the driving force for development.

    Although the cost of living is high and it is difficult to save money, the main reasons why big cities still attract many people are:

    1.There are many job opportunities. Large cities have developed economies and usually offer more job opportunities, especially some high-paying and high-skilled jobs. This attracts many motivated and skilled people to develop in big cities.

    2.There is a lot of room for development. Large cities usually have larger business organizations and provide a broader platform for the development of professional judgments. This provides greater room for aspirants to develop and achieve higher social and economic status by working.

    3.Good infrastructure. Large cities have more developed infrastructure and public services, and are more convenient in transportation, medical care, education, etc., which is also an important factor in attracting population.

    4.Consumption and entertainment are abundant. Big cities have a well-developed consumer and entertainment industry, bringing together high-end products and cultural resources to provide a rich and diverse consumer experience. This satisfies the new and interesting consumption and entertainment needs of many people.

    5.The exchange of information is extensive. The flow of information in large cities is more convenient and extensive, which is conducive to people-to-people exchanges and interactions. This has led many people to pursue broader networks and more platform-based information exchange in big cities.

    6.There is a strong atmosphere of anonymity. The large mobility and low correlation of the population in large cities allow people to remain more anonymous and live and work more freely. This attracts the lifestyle that some people are pursuing.

    In summary, although it is true that the cost of living in big cities is higher and the ability to save money is lower, they also provide more opportunities, broader development space and richer life experiences. For many people with ideals and aspirations, the appeal of big cities far outweighs the cost of living. The change of noise in big cities represents not only survival, but also an ideal, a richer life possibility.

    That's why big cities are always the centers of population.

    Of course, everyone's pursuit of life is different. If the cost of living and saving money are top of mind, the attractiveness of a big city is greatly diminished. It depends on each person's needs and preferences.

    Overall, however, the reason why large cities have become centers of population is that the opportunities and conveniences they provide far outweigh the cost of living, which is the root cause of the boom in big cities.
